The Australian Bureau of Statistics identifies Aeronautical Engineer under ANZSCO 233911. The occupation involves engineering work connected with the design, development, manufacture, maintenance and modification of aircraft for flight. Aerospace Engineer and Avionics Systems Engineer are also listed among its recognised specialisations.

Engineers Australia explains that the Competency Demonstration Report pathway evaluates an applicant’s knowledge, skills and competencies against the standards applying to the nominated engineering occupation.

What Is an Aeronautical Engineer CDR?

A Competency Demonstration Report is used by eligible applicants following the CDR assessment pathway to demonstrate their engineering competencies.

For an Aeronautical Engineer, the report should explain how you personally applied engineering principles to aircraft, propulsion, aerodynamics, aviation systems, structural components, maintenance operations or related aerospace projects.

A strong report does not simply describe an aircraft or repeat general engineering theory. It demonstrates:

Engineering Challenge & Responsibility: Describe the engineering problem, your role, and the responsibilities you personally handled.

Technical Approach & Decision-Making: Explain the calculations, analyses, software, standards, and how you evaluated and selected the best methods or materials.

Safety, Quality & Outcomes: Summarize how you managed safety, risk, and quality, and the results or impact achieved through your contribution.

What Should an Aeronautical Engineer CDR Sample Contain?

1. Curriculum Vitae

Present your academic qualifications, employment history, engineering roles, major projects and professional responsibilities in chronological order.

Include relevant technical skills, software knowledge, training activities and professional memberships related to aeronautical engineering.

Ensure that all dates, job titles, organisations and project details are consistent with the career episodes and supporting documents

2.Continuing Professional Development

Include relevant training, workshops, seminars, conferences, technical courses and independent learning activities completed after formal education.

Mention professional development in aircraft design, maintenance, aerodynamics, propulsion, aviation safety and software such as MATLAB, ANSYS, CATIA or SolidWorks.

Present the CPD record clearly with the activity title, provider, date, duration and learning outcome rather than writing it as a career episode.

3.Three Career Episodes

Describe three separate engineering projects or experiences drawn from university work, research, internships, maintenance assignments or professional employment.

Explain your personal responsibilities, calculations, technical decisions, software applications, engineering challenges and solutions in each episode.

Ensure that the three episodes collectively demonstrate technical knowledge, problem-solving, communication, project management and professional competency.

4.Summary Statement

Connect every required competency element with the relevant numbered paragraphs from the three career episodes.

Use accurate references such as PE1.2–CE1.8, CE1.11 and CE2.14 to show where each competency has been demonstrated.

Check that every reference leads to clear evidence of engineering knowledge, technical application, communication or professional responsibility
